天天看點

一步一步搞定InfoPath(02)--配置VSTA

VSTA(Visual Studio Tools for Applications)安裝

計算機需要安裝了 Microsoft .NET Framework 2.0 或更高版本。預設情況下,當您安裝 InfoPath 時,并不會安裝 Microsoft Visual Studio Tools for Applications 開發環境。若要安裝 Microsoft Visual Studio Tools for Applications,必須在初次安裝時選擇“自定義”,或使用“添加或删除功能”來更新 Office 或 InfoPath 安裝,以包含 Microsoft Visual Studio Tools for Applications。可通過在安裝程式中展開“Microsoft Office InfoPath”和“.NET 可程式設計性支援”來找到用于安裝 Microsoft Visual Studio Tools for Applications 的選項。

2.    選擇程式設計語言

       修改程式設計語言的話,點選開發工具->語言,進行修改。我機器上預設是c#,是以不用修改了。

3.    小demo測試環境

       目标:在表單中添加兩個控件:按鈕和文本框。當單擊按鈕時彈出messagebox顯示“Hello!”。

       實作步驟:

       設計表單:在InfoPath建立 .xsn 檔案,并且添加文本框和按鈕控件。

       添加按鈕事件 :右鍵按鈕控件,在正常頁籤中 點選“編輯表單代碼”按鈕(如下圖所示),打開vs環境。

    添加事件代碼:由MessageBox屬于System.Windows.Form命名空間,是以首先要添加引用。

              發現智能感覺提供的方法中有mbox,怎麼用呢? 好像是用回車,空格,tab鍵都不行。

            我們在工具欄中打開 編輯->IntelliSense->插入代碼段->mbox->Tab鍵,得到如下代碼段。

    測試結果:有兩種方式可以啟動預覽。一是在InfoPath中單擊“預覽”按鈕;而是直接點選vs中的調試按鈕。執行成功。

    本文轉自 陳敬(Cathy) 部落格園部落格,原文連結:http://www.cnblogs.com/janes/archive/2011/04/02/2002981.html,如需轉載請自行聯系原作者

繼續閱讀